You can spend the night in a real haunted mansion in Ontario

Prepare to be scared. If Halloween Haunt isn’t spooky enough for you, this haunted mansion in Ontario is the real deal and you can spend a night there in October.

Located in Penetanguishene, the Beck House is a red brick Victorian house dating from 1885.

According to the description of the house on Airbnb, the Beck house was once owned by a lumber baron named Charles Beck, his wife and nine children.

Charles was a very influential man at the time, building much of the city, as well as a large mill, general store, and box factory in Toronto.
